Summary of State Laws With Broad/General Applicability (rev. 2016)

Note: links embedded in word “Statute” or “Legislature” depending on availability

STATE STATUTORY RELIANCE COVERAGE RESTRICTS

TERMINATION NOTICE REQUIREMENT BUY BACK

REQUIREMENT ANTI-WAIVER PROVISION

OTHER

Alaska

Statutes

Alaska Stat. §§ 45.45.700 – 45.45.790

Alaska Stat. §§ 45.45.700 – 45.45.930

Broad applicability to “distributors” and “dealers”; does not apply to: gas/petroleum franchises, motor vehicle distributors, alcohol distributors, cigarette distributors, food and drink distributors, marine product or motorized recreational product distributors, or manufacturers with 50 or fewer employees.

No. No. Yes, including substantial payment obligations following termination or substantial change in competitive situation.

Yes, see Alaska Stat. § 45.45.750

Alaska Stat. §§ 45.45.700 – 45.45.930

Prohibits distributorship agreements that require waiver of jury trial, require arbitration or other ADR, require dealer payment of distributor’s attorney fees, or include choice of law provisions that apply law of state other than Alaska; prohibits coercion of dealers through duress or threats of termination.

Arkansas

Statutes

Arkansas Franchise Practices Act: Ark. Code Ann. §§ 4-72-201 – 4-72-210

Arkansas Code

Broad applicability to “franchises” (no franchise fee required); does not apply to petroleum product franchises.

Yes, requires “good cause.”

Yes, 90 days notice with 30 days to cure (with certain exceptions).

Yes, if termination is not for good cause.

Yes, see Ark. Code Ann. § 4-72-206 (1)

Arkansas Code

California

Statutes

California Franchise Relations Act: Cal. Bus. & Prof. Code §§ 20000 – 20043

“Franchises” (franchise fee required); does not apply to petroleum product franchises and motor vehicle franchises.

Yes, requires “good cause.”

For pre-2016 agreements: Yes, notice with reasonable opportunity of up to 30 days to cure (with certain exceptions). For post-2016 agreements: notice with reasonable opportunity of up to 75 days.

For pre-2016 agreements: Yes, if termination is in violation of statute. For post-2016 agreements: Yes, with certain exceptions.

Yes, see Cal. Bus. & Prof. Code §20010

and Cal. Bus. & Prof. Code §20040.5

California Fair Dealership Law, Cal. Civ. Code §§ 80 – 86

“Dealerships.” No. No. No. Yes, see Cal. Civ. Code § 82(b)

Prohibits discrimination in termination, grant, sale, or non-renewal of “dealerships” based on race, color, religion, national origin, ancestry, or sex.

Connecticut

Statutes

Conn. Gen. Stat. §§ 42-133e – 42-133h

Conn. Gen. Stat. §§ 42-126a - 133mm

Broad applicability to “franchises” (no franchise fee required).

Yes, requires “good cause.”

Yes, 60 days notice (with certain exceptions requiring shorter or longer periods).

Yes. Yes, see Conn. Gen. Stat. § 42-133 f (f)

Delaware

Statutes

Delaware Franchise Security Law: Del. Code Ann. Title 6, §§ 2551 – 2557

“Franchises” (franchise fee over $100 required).

Yes, prohibits “unjust” terminations – in bad faith or without good cause.

Yes, 90 days notice. No. No, but see Del. Code Ann. Title 6, §2552 and § 2555

Del. Code Ann. Title 6, §§ 2551 - 2557

Hawaii

Legislature

Hawaii Franchise Investment Law: Haw. Rev. Stat. §§ 482E-1 – 482E-12

“Franchises” (franchise fee required).

Yes, requires “good cause.”

Yes; failure to comply with franchise agreement after notice and reasonable time to cure constitutes good cause.

Yes. Yes, see Haw. Rev. Stat. § 482E-6(F)

Prohibits sale of a franchise in Hawaii unless prospective franchisee has been given, at least seven days prior to the sale of the franchise, an offering circular containing certain information.

Idaho

Statutes

Idaho Code § 29-110 “Franchises” (franchise fee over $1000 required).

No. No. No. Yes, see Idaho Code § 29-110 Prohibits franchisor from requiring franchisee to sign an agreement waiving venue or jurisdiction of the Idaho court system or shortening the statute of limitations.

Illinois

Statutes

Illinois Franchise Disclosure Law: 815 ILCS §§ 705/1 – 705/44

“Franchises” (franchise fee over $500 required).

Yes, “good cause” required for termination prior to expiration of term.

Yes, failure to comply with franchise agreement after notice and failure to cure in 30 days constitutes good cause (with certain exceptions requiring shorter or longer periods).

Yes, when there is a failure to renew absent 6 months notice or where non-compete provision prohibits franchisee from engaging in similar business under a different franchise.

Yes, see 815 ILCS § 705/4 and § 705/41

Illinois Franchise Disclosure Law: 815 ILCS §§ 705/1 – 705/44

Indiana

Legislature

Indiana Deceptive Franchise Practices Act: Ind. Code §§ 23-2-2.7-1 – 23-2-2.7-7

“Franchises” (franchise fee required); also includes motor vehicle and gasoline franchises even in absence of a franchise fee.

Yes, requires “good cause.”

Yes, 90 days notice (unless agreement provides otherwise).

No. Yes, see Indiana Code § 23-2-2.7-1(5) and (10)

Ind. Code §§ 23-2-2.7-1 – 23-2-2.7-7

See also Ind. Code §§ 23-2-2.5-0.5 – 23-2-2.5-51 (franchise sales)

Iowa

Statutes

Iowa Code §§ Iowa Code 523H.1 – 523H.17 (prior to 7/1/2000); § 537A.10 (on or after 7/1/2000)

“Franchises” (franchise fee required; limits types of “indirect” franchise fees).

Yes, requires “good cause” prior to expiration of term.

Yes, notice with 30-90 days to cure (with certain exceptions requiring shorter or longer periods).

Only with respect to enforceability of non-compete agreements (if prior to 7/1/2000).

Yes, see Iowa Code § 523H.3(1), § 523H.4, and § 523H.14; see also Iowa Code §§ 537A.10(3), (4), and (14)

Iowa Code §§ 523H.1 – 523H.17 (prior to 7/1/2000); § 537A.10 (on or after 7/1/2000)

Imposes duty of “good faith”; good-faith requirement specifically applies (if after 7/1/2000) where franchisor opens new outlet that has adverse impact on franchisee.

Louisiana

Statutes

La. Rev. Stat. § 23:921

“Franchises” as defined in 16 C.F.R. 436.2(c).

No. No. No. No. A franchise agreement may require that franchisee and franchisor are restricted from competing with one another during term of the agreement. Non-compete period after termination may not exceed 2 years.

Maryland

Statutes

Maryland Fair Distributorship Act: Md. Code Ann., Comm. §§ 11-1301 – 11-1307

Code of Maryland (Statutes)

Broad Applicability to “distributors”; does not apply to: seller of business opportunities regulated under Maryland Business Opportunity Sales Act, franchisors regulated under Maryland Franchise Registration and Disclosure Law, supplier regulated under Equipment Dealer Contract Act, manufacturer/ producer/refiner of motor fuels, franchisor regulated under Beer Franchise Fair Dealing Act, manufacturer/ producer/supplier of wine or distilled spirits.

Notice required. Yes, 60 days notice with opportunity to cure (with certain exceptions requiring shorter or longer periods). Distributor may oppose termination with plan to correct deficiencies, requiring good-faith effort by grantor and distributor to mutually adopt corrective plan.

Yes. No, but see Md. Code Ann., Comm. § 11-1307(a)

Code of Maryland (Statutes)

See also Md. Code Ann., Bus. Reg. §§ 14-201 – 14-305 (franchise sales)

Code of Maryland (Statutes)

Michigan

Statutes

Michigan Franchise Investment Law: Mich. Comp. Laws §§ 445.1501 – 445.1546

“Franchises” (franchise fee required).

Yes, prohibits document provisions that permit termination prior to expiration of term without “good cause.”

Yes, failure to comply with franchise agreement after notice and 30 days to cure constitutes good cause.

Yes, for certain non-renewals.

Yes, see Mich. Comp. Laws § 445.1527(b)

Minnesota

Statutes

Minn. Stat. §§ 80C.01 – 80C.22

“Franchises” (franchise fee required); includes motor fuel franchises (even in absence of franchise fee) but excludes motor vehicle franchises.

Yes, good cause required.

Yes, 90 days notice with 60 days to cure (with certain exceptions requiring shorter or longer periods).

No; but for non-renewal, franchisee must be given “sufficient” time to operate to attempt to recover value of franchise as a going concern.

Yes, see Minn. Stat. §§ 80C.21

Rhode Island

Statutes

Rhode Island Fair Dealership Act: R.I. Gen Laws §§ 6-50-1 – 6-50-9

Broad applicability to “dealerships”; does not apply to alcohol dealerships, motor vehicle dealerships, insurance agencies, fuel distribution dealerships, or door-to-door sales dealerships.

Notice required; “good cause” is defined in the statute, but termination is not restricted to “good cause.”

Yes, 60 days notice with 30 days to cure (with certain exceptions requiring shorter or longer periods).

Yes. Yes, see R.I. Gen Laws § 6-50-3(c)

R.I. Gen Laws § 6-50-3(c)

South Dakota

Statutes

S.D. Codified Laws §§ 37-5-1 – 37-5-12.4

S.D. Codified Laws §§ 37-5-1 – 37-5-19

“Dealers” of “merchandise” (across varied industries including motor vehicles, trailers, farm implements and machinery, industrial and construction equipment, watercraft, snowmobiles, all-terrain vehicles, office furniture and equipment, outdoor power equipment, temperature control units, idle reduction or temperature management systems, and auxiliary power units).

Yes, prohibits “unfair” cancellation, without due regard for equities of dealer and without just provocation.

No notice period is specified.

Yes. Yes, see S.D. Codified Laws § 37-5-12

See S.D. Codified Laws §§ 37-5B-1 – 37-5B-53 (franchise sales).

Virgin Islands

Statutes

V.I. Code Ann. Title 12a, §§ 130 –139

Virgin Islands Code

Broad applicability to “franchises.”

Yes, requires “good cause.”

Yes, 120 days notice. No. No, but see V.I. Code Ann. Title 12a, § 133

Virgin Islands Code

Virginia

Statutes

Virginia Retail Franchising Act: Va. Code Ann. §§ 13.1-557 – 13.1-574

“Franchises” (franchise fee over $500 required)

Yes, requires “reasonable cause.”

No notice period is specified.

No. Yes, see Va. Code Ann. § 13.1-571(c)

Washington

Statutes

Washington Franchise Investment Protection Act: Wash. Rev. Code §§ 19.100.010 – 19.100.940

“Franchises” (franchise fee required)

Yes, requires “good cause” prior to expiration of term.

Yes; failure to comply with franchise agreement after notice and 30 days to cure constitutes good cause (with certain exceptions).

Yes. Yes, see Wash Rev. Code §19.100.180(g)

and Wash. Rev. Code § 19.100.220(2)

Imposes obligation to deal in “good faith.”

Wisconsin

Statutes

Wisconsin Fair Dealership Law: Wis. Stat. §§ 135.01 - 135.07

Broadly applicable to “dealers.” Yes, requires good cause.

Yes, 90 days notice with 60 days to cure (with certain exceptions requiring shorter or longer periods).

Yes. Yes, see Wis. Stat. § 135.025(3)

Wis. Stat. §§ 135.01 - 135.07
